Output ec98cf2202987e964cc8d12e860e85c08c1f8a1bb5eea685173ccae6b4580ebd:1

value
390628256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9a5198931249e713614831af6bcf09d9104fe5 OP_EQUAL
address
34PYPMrtAdn5rMtgYRZhN5Fe5TTGQjEt3L
transaction
ec98cf2202987e964cc8d12e860e85c08c1f8a1bb5eea685173ccae6b4580ebd
confirmations
322104
spent
true